About 8 Briar Close
8 Briar Close is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Newport, Brough, Brough (HU15 2QY).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(April 2018)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since December 2016.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Today's modelled estimate of £168,000 is 46.1%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£142/sq ft) was about 18.4% below the postcode norm. Last changed hands 9 years ago, in July 2017.
